Mobile City Hall Coming Tuesday To 19th Ward
19th Ward residents can purchase city stickers, residential parking permits, dog license and CityKey Tuesday, Aug. 24 at Mt. Greenwood Park.

CHICAGO — The Office of the City Clerk is partnering with the 19th Ward and City departments to bring City Hall's services Tuesday, Aug. 24, at Mount Greenwood Park, 3721 W. 111th St. Residents can purchase city stickers, residential parking permits, dog licenses, and get their CityKey ID from 11 a.m. to 2 p.m.
The CityKey is a free optional government-issued ID card available to all Chicagoans regardless of age, gender, immigration status, or housing status. It serves as a government- issued ID, a Chicago Public Library Card, a Chicago Transit Authority Ventra Card, and a Chicago Rx prescription drug discount card. CityKey holders are also eligible for the many discounts and benefits offered by participating CityKey business partners across the city.
